LONG VOWEL /I:/

6

  • Tongue height: High
  • Position of the tongue: Front

(The tongue tip is in the highest position)

  • Lips: Unrounded, spead

(like when you smile)

  • Jaw: close
  • Long sound

7 of 21

SHORT VOWEL /I/

7

  • Tongue height: High
  • Position of the tongue: Front

(The tongue tip is lower than that in /i:/

  • Lips: Unrounded, relaxed
  • Jaw: Near close
  • Short sound

Common spelling patterns

/i:/

ee

Three, free, see

ea

Tea, meal, easy

ie/ei

Chief, believe, receive

e+consonant+e

Scene, fever, athlete

ique

Unique, boutique, antique

/ɪ/

i

Pig, ill, trick

Est

Biggest, fastest,simplest

y

Gym, system, physics

ui

Build, biscuit, guitar
